7.1.8 Navigation view
The navigation views present the menu structure of the device. All menu items are uniquely
identified with menu item number.
Level 1 of the navigation view (entered from the operation view) is standardized for all Siemens
Process Instrumentation devices and covers the following groups:
1. Quick Start (menu): Lists the most important parameters for quick configuration of the
device. All parameters in this view can be found elsewhere in the menu.
2. Setup (menu): Contains all parameters which are needed to configure the device.
3. Maintenance & Diagnostics (menu): Contains parameters which affect the product behavior
regarding maintenance, diagnostics and service.
Examples: Verification, failure prediction, device health, data logging, alarm logging, report,
condition, monitoring, tests, etc.
4. Communication (menu): Contains parameters which describe the Profibus, Profinet, HART,
Modbus, X-bus communication settings of the device.
